On-Site Photovoltaic Solar Power For Data Centers Market Overview

On-Site Photovoltaic Solar Power For Data Centers Market (USD Million)

On-Site Photovoltaic Solar Power For Data Centers Market was valued at USD 2398.45 million in the year 2024. The size of this market is expected to increase to USD 6379.93 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 15.0%.

The On-Site Photovoltaic Solar Power for Data Centers Market is gaining strong momentum as operators focus on sustainable energy adoption and reducing dependence on non-renewable sources. Nearly 45% of data centers are actively integrating solar solutions to power operations, ensuring reliability, cost efficiency, and environmental sustainability. This adoption aligns with industry-wide goals of minimizing carbon impact while enhancing energy independence.

Rising Demand for Energy Efficiency
Growing computational workloads and digital traffic have significantly increased energy requirements, fueling the shift toward on-site solar power generation. Around 40% of operators report improved efficiency and reduced power costs after adopting photovoltaic systems. The market is driven by the dual advantage of energy savings and operational resilience, making solar integration a priority investment.

Technological Integration Accelerating Growth
Advanced solar panel technologies, AI-driven energy management, and smart grid connectivity are propelling adoption in this sector. Nearly 50% of new installations feature intelligent monitoring and automation for optimized energy distribution. These integrations enable continuous energy availability, reduced dependency on grids, and enhanced performance, ensuring a reliable power backbone for mission-critical data centers.

Sustainability Driving Market Adoption
The emphasis on green data centers and corporate sustainability strategies has boosted market adoption. Over 55% of enterprises highlight solar power as a cornerstone of their environmental, social, and governance (ESG) commitments. This rising preference for clean and renewable energy sources is reshaping the energy infrastructure of the data center industry.

Future Growth Outlook
The On-Site Photovoltaic Solar Power for Data Centers Market shows strong expansion potential, supported by digitalization, automation, and renewable integration trends. Close to 60% of data center operators plan to increase their reliance on solar power over the next decade. Continuous advancements in energy storage systems and hybrid solar solutions will further strengthen market growth and long-term sustainability.
